If I want to get an out-of-body experience before a night sleep, I go
to bed, take an UNcomfortable position and try to fall asleep...
NOTHING ELSE. Usually I will not be falling asleep but will get a
very deep free-floating state of mind. After 1-3 lapses in
consciousness I can easily get a phase. Not right... The phase comes to
me by itself.
- I use some other techniques only in 15-20% of cases (to calm my mind if it is too awake, or to make it more alert if it is too sleepy).
- You should only have a slight desire to get into the phase. Strong desire ruins everything. I almost do not think about the phase when using this method.
- If there is no result in 15 minutes, change position to comfortable and then try to really fall asleep.
